1042-S is just the same as a 1099 but generally issued to nonresident aliens with backup withholding or without withholding due to treaty or IRC applications.  It could also be issued to a US person who did not certify his/her US status.

You would report the income on the usual forms/schedules/lines, depending on the type of income it is.  You will be able to identify the type of income it is based on the income code by referring to the table on the form.
